## Flaky DNS resolution on Lanternfish workers

Every few days a Lanternfish worker in the Ostvale region starts failing lookups for the Quillgate API, then recovers on its own. We're fairly sure it's the local caching resolver hitting its negative-TTL ceiling, not anything upstream. From a security angle: no evidence of spoofing, responses validate fine, and we pinned the resolver list last quarter. If it recurs, restart the stub resolver and capture a pcap before anything else. The resolver and retry behavior come straight from this config.

service settings:
WENOX_PIN=1918
WENOX_METRICS_HOST=metrics.wenox.lumicworks.corp
WENOX_LOG_LEVEL=info
WENOX_TENANT=belion

Alert: Pool Saturation — Quillbase Primary. This alert fires when the Quillbase connection pool on the Ledgerline service stays above 90% utilization for five minutes. New joiners: this usually means a slow query is holding connections, not that the database is down. Check recent deploys first, then look at active query age. Full triage steps are documented on the internal page below.

dashboard of yahaf-kajep = https://jira.zemvarsys.internal/display/projects/browse/browse/a08b

### Connection Pooling

Orchard Relay services share a single pool per database shard. New team members often oversize pools; that starves the Fennwick primary and trips failover. Keep per-service pools small and rely on queueing. Idle connections are reaped aggressively because shard leases expire every few minutes. Never bypass the pool for ad hoc queries. Pool behavior is governed entirely by the constants below.

limits module of fajog-tawig:
RATE_LIMITS = {
    "druwyn": 2,
    "quenael": 10,
    "wenix": 2,
    "druael": 2,
}